.create eller alter continuous-export
Gäller för: ✅Microsoft Fabric✅Azure Data Explorer
Skapar eller ändrar ett kontinuerligt exportjobb.
Behörigheter
Du måste ha minst databasadministratör behörighet att köra det här kommandot.
Syntax
.create-or-alter
continuous-export
continuousExportName [over
(
T1, T2)
] to
table
externalTableName [with
(
propertyName=
propertyValue [,
...])
] <|
fråga
Läs mer om syntaxkonventioner.
Parametrar
Namn | Typ | Krävs | Beskrivning |
---|---|---|---|
continuousExportName | string |
✔️ | Namnet på den kontinuerliga exporten. Måste vara unikt i databasen. |
externalTableName | string |
✔️ | Namnet på den externa tabellen exportmål. |
fråga | string |
✔️ | Frågan som ska exporteras. |
T1, T2 | string |
En kommaavgränsad lista över faktatabeller i frågan. Om de inte anges antas alla tabeller som refereras i frågan vara faktatabeller. Om det anges behandlas tabeller inte i den här listan som dimensionstabeller och är inte begränsade, så alla poster deltar i alla exporter. Mer information finns i översikt över kontinuerlig dataexport. | |
propertyName, propertyValue | string |
En kommaavgränsad lista över valfria egenskaper. |
Not
Om den externa måltabellen använder personifiering autentisering måste du ange en hanterad identitet för att köra den kontinuerliga exporten. Mer information finns i Använda en hanterad identitet för att köra ett kontinuerligt exportjobb.
Egenskaper som stöds
Egenskap | Typ | Beskrivning |
---|---|---|
intervalBetweenRuns |
Timespan |
Tidsintervallet mellan kontinuerliga exportkörningar. Måste vara större än 1 minut. |
forcedLatency |
Timespan |
En valfri tidsperiod för att begränsa frågan till poster som matas in före en angiven period i förhållande till den aktuella tiden. Den här egenskapen är användbar om till exempel frågan utför vissa sammansättningar eller kopplingar, och du vill kontrollera att alla relevanta poster har matats in innan du kör exporten. |
sizeLimit |
long |
Storleksgränsen i byte för en enda lagringsartefakt som skrivits före komprimering. Giltigt intervall: 100 MB (standard) till 1 GB. |
distributed |
bool |
Inaktivera eller aktivera distribuerad export. Inställningen false motsvarar single distributionstips. Standardvärdet är sant. |
parquetRowGroupSize |
int |
Relevant endast när dataformatet är Parquet. Styr radgruppens storlek i de exporterade filerna. Standardstorleken för radgrupper är 100 000 poster. |
managedIdentity |
string |
Den hanterade identitet som det kontinuerliga exportjobbet körs för. Den hanterade identiteten kan vara ett objekt-ID eller det system reserverade ordet. Mer information finns i Använda en hanterad identitet för att köra ett kontinuerligt exportjobb. |
isDisabled |
bool |
Inaktivera eller aktivera kontinuerlig export. Standardvärdet är falskt. |
Exempel
I följande exempel skapas eller ändras en kontinuerlig export MyExport
som exporterar data från tabellen T
till ExternalBlob
. Dataexporten sker varje timme och har en definierad tvingad svarstid och storleksgräns per lagringsartefakt.
.create-or-alter continuous-export MyExport
over (T)
to table ExternalBlob
with
(intervalBetweenRuns=1h,
forcedLatency=10m,
sizeLimit=104857600)
<| T
Namn | ExternalTableName | Fråga | ForcedLatency | IntervalBetweenRuns | CursorScopedTables | ExportEgenskaper |
---|---|---|---|---|---|---|
MyExport | ExternalBlob | S | 00:10:00 | 01:00:00 | [ "['DB']. ['S']" ] |
{ "SizeLimit": 104857600 } |